For members of the Center Moriches Fire Department, water rescue training never ends.

Even though we are in the winter season, duck hunters and other winter fisherman are always out on the bay. Residents also take to the Ice in our local ponds to ice skate and take part in other winter activities.

This time of the year our training fucuses on cold water / ice rescue training.

Pool training allows our members to keep up their skills and practice rescue techniques while wearing a special type of dry suit that protects the rescue swimmer from hypothermia while immersed in ice cold water.

Members of the Center Moriches Fire Department Water Rescue Team are highly trained personnel who are ready to respond to any type of emergency on the water at a moment’s notice year-round.
